By September 2024, a teacher’s … Webb26 feb. 2024 · Teachers In 2010, the starting salary for teachers in England and Wales outside of London was £21,600. In 2024, for a newly qualified teacher, the figure is £24,400. Although this seems like a small increase, in real terms, the starting salary has decreased by 6%. Webb14 dec. 2024 · Career average revalued earnings scheme which provides benefits based on your earnings each year which are revalued annually to keep pace with inflation. Current accrual rate of 1/57 of pensionable earnings in each year. Revaluation for current members is linked to Consumer Price Index plus 1.6%.
